Serving 341 students in grades Prekindergarten-3, Holloway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is approximately equal to the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-64% (which is approximately equal to the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is equal to the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 45%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).

- Attendance Zone: Holloway Elementary School serves the southeastern part of Holland, OH, encompassing an area of approximately 3 square miles. Families within this zone can typically expect a drive of 5 to 10 minutes to reach the school, with the furthest edge being about 1.6 miles away.

Holloway Elementary School's student population of 341 students has declined by 10% over five school years.
The teacher population of 20 teachers has declined by 9% over five school years.
